Recipe's preparation
- Chop basil leaves, 5 sec, speed 7
Remove from bowl and save.
Place peaches and lemon juice in bowl
Cook 30 min, 100c speed 3. MC off and place simmer basket on to prevent splashing.
Add sugar to taste and cook another 10 mins 100c, speed 3. - To test if ready place spoonful on ceramic plate in fridge for 2 mins to test if it gels and forms a solid paste.
If not cook another 10min, 100C, speed 3 as needed.
Add basil to taste and mix 15sec, speed 5.
Be careful of hot paste splattering.
Pour/spoon into silcone mini muffin trays and set in fridge.
Alternatively I set mine in shallow plastic dishes and scoop paste out for cheese platters.
Peach and Basil paste

Tip
This was my first attempt and I couldn't get it to set like a fruit paste, it was more like a jam.
However I froze it in the silicone trays and was able to flip each piece out to store.
